What it actually says
/verify-pr
Lightweight PR verification — runs the verify-deployment skill in "static" mode (against the PR diff, not a deployed URL).
Usage
/verify-pr 123
/verify-pr https://github.com/<org>/<repo>/pull/123
What it does
- Fetches the PR via GitHub MCP.
- Reads the contract ID from the PR title or body (formats:
[SC-005],Closes #issue-with-contract, or branch name prefix). - Loads the contract revision.
- For each AC, checks:
- Is there a Playwright test referencing this AC?
- Did the test pass in the latest CI run?
- Looks for things the contract requires but the diff doesn't add:
- Instrumentation events not fired in code
- Feature flag gate missing
- i18n strings hardcoded
- Posts a review comment with the coverage table and any gaps.
When to use
- After the Implementer finishes, before human review.
- Re-runs automatically on every push to the PR (via
pr-verify.yml). - Manually invokable if you want to re-check a stalled PR.
Output
A PR review comment with:
- ✅/❌ per AC
- Missing instrumentation calls
- Missing feature flag gates
- Quality nits (TODOs, console.logs, etc.)
